A distant and possibly mythical desert in the far east of Middle-earth, the abode of the Were-worms.

It is not clear if the Last Desert could really fit in the known maps of Arda, or if it was simply a creation of Hobbitish folklore, though it may be refering to the Harad Desert or The Land of the Sun.
